Ingredients You’ll Need
Gathering the right ingredients for this Fish Taco Slaw Recipe is both straightforward and rewarding. Each component plays a crucial role in layering crispness, freshness, and zest into every bite of your slaw.
- Coleslaw mix: A convenient blend of shredded cabbage and carrots that forms the crunchy base of the slaw.
- Red onion: Thinly sliced for a subtle sharpness and beautiful pops of purple color.
- Cilantro: Finely chopped to impart a bright, herbaceous freshness that livens up the dish.
- Jalapeño: Finely chopped and optional, but highly recommended for a gentle heat that awakens your taste buds.
- Lime juice: The key acidic element that adds zing and ties all the flavors together.
- Salt: Just the right amount to bring out the natural sweetness of the vegetables and balance the acidity.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
If you have any leftover Fish Taco Slaw Recipe, store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It keeps well for up to 3 days, though it’s freshest when enjoyed within the first day since the lime juice can soften the cabbage over time.
Freezing
This slaw is best enjoyed fresh and does not freeze well because the texture will become limp and watery after thawing. For peak quality, avoid freezing.
Reheating
Since this is a fresh, chilled slaw, reheating isn’t necessary or recommended. Simply stir the slaw gently before serving cold or at room temperature for the best taste and crunch.
FAQs
Can I make the Fish Taco Slaw Recipe spicier?
Absolutely! You can add extra jalapeño or even a pinch of cayenne pepper to kick up the heat. Just be mindful to balance the spice so it doesn’t overpower the freshness of the lime and cilantro.
What if I don’t like cilantro?
If cilantro isn’t your thing, fresh parsley or chopped green onions are excellent substitutes that still provide a fresh herbal note without the distinctive flavor of cilantro.
Is there a substitute for coleslaw mix?
You can use finely shredded green and purple cabbage along with grated carrots if you prefer to prepare your own mix. This lets you control textures and freshness perfectly.
Can I prepare the Fish Taco Slaw Recipe ahead of time?
Yes, but it’s best to prepare it no more than a few hours in advance. The cabbage will release water over time, so keeping it separate until just before serving can help maintain the crunch.
How long will the slaw last in the fridge?
The slaw stays fresh in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. After that, it tends to lose crunch and may become watery due to the lime juice.

Description
A quick and refreshing Fish Taco Slaw that combines crisp coleslaw mix, tangy lime juice, and a hint of heat from jalapeño, perfect as a vibrant topping for air fryer fish tacos or as a light side dish.
Ingredients
Slaw Mix
- 1 (14-ounce) bag coleslaw mix
Fresh Vegetables & Herbs
- ¼ cup red onion, thinly sliced
- ¼ cup cilantro, finely chopped
- 1 jalapeño, finely chopped (optional)
Seasoning
- 1 lime, juiced
- ½ teaspoon salt, or to taste
Instructions
- Combine ingredients: Place the coleslaw mix, thinly sliced red onion, finely chopped cilantro, and jalapeño (if using) into a large mixing bowl.
- Add lime juice and salt: Pour the fresh lime juice over the vegetables and sprinkle with salt according to your taste preference.
- Toss to combine: Using tongs or two large spoons, toss all the ingredients together thoroughly until the slaw is evenly coated and mixed.
- Serve or store: Serve the slaw immediately as a topping for air fryer fish tacos, or refrigerate it until ready to use, allowing flavors to meld for a few hours if preferred. Enjoy your fresh and zesty slaw!
Notes
- For extra crunch, add sliced radishes or chopped bell peppers.
- If you prefer less heat, omit the jalapeño or use seeded jalapeño.
- This slaw pairs perfectly with any fish taco recipe, especially those cooked in an air fryer.
- Make ahead and refrigerate up to 24 hours; it will keep well and flavors intensify over time.
- Adjust salt and lime juice to taste for best flavor balance.
